Indie game develop can be quite challenging. You don’t only have to program, but also you have to design your game, make it look beautiful, add music and market your game. In this podcast we will talk with other indie game developers about their experiences regarding these topics. From their successes, failures, insights and their tips for you to continue this indie game dev journey

Mike Capozzi is an indie game dev who has a full time job, a family with 2 child under 5 years old and above all of this, he managed to release his indie game. He shares great tips to market your indie game and his story as indie game developer.
